Transaction 63e65e0b0650e4112e940e292948b14dfac48dba6c39c9766692c20fa63afb59

5 Input
2 Outputs
  • 63e65e0b0650e4112e940e292948b14dfac48dba6c39c9766692c20fa63afb59:0
  • value  1629200000
    address  1FqfKbwCcoHZZR8U2CpcBeGNaD5XxnaZpG
  • 63e65e0b0650e4112e940e292948b14dfac48dba6c39c9766692c20fa63afb59:1
  • value  849413050
    address  1L4ojXhYhLA1u5AcYrHzr4kLbRnYmKFhW4